Condividi tramite


CHotKeyCtrl::SetRules

Chiamare la funzione per definire le combinazioni non valide e la combinazione predefinita del modificatore per un controllo del tasto di scelta.

void SetRules(
   WORD wInvalidComb,
   WORD wModifiers 
);

Parametri

  • wInvalidComb
    Matrice di flag che specifica le combinazioni di tasti non valide.Può essere una combinazione dei valori seguenti:

    • HKCOMB_A ALT.

    • HKCOMB_C CTRL

    • HKCOMB_CA CTRL+ALT

    • Chiavi diHKCOMB_NONE invariate

    • HKCOMB_S MAIUSC

    • HKCOMB_SA SHIFT+ALT

    • HKCOMB_SC MAIUSC+CTRL

    • HKCOMB_SCA SHIFT+CTRL+ALT

  • wModifiers
    Matrice di flag che specifica la combinazione di tasti da utilizzare quando l'utente immette una combinazione non valida.Per ulteriori informazioni sui flag di modificatori, vedere GetHotKey.

Note

Quando un utente immette una combinazione di tasti non valida, come definito dai flag specificati in wInvalidComb, viene utilizzato l'operatore OR per combinare le chiavi immesse dall'utente con i flag specificati in wModifiers.La combinazione di tasti risultante viene convertita in una stringa e quindi visualizzata nel controllo del tasto di scelta.

Requisiti

Header: afxcmn.h

Vedere anche

Riferimenti

Classe di CHotKeyCtrl

Grafico della gerarchia

CHotKeyCtrl::GetHotKey

CHotKeyCtrl::SetHotKey